Gertrude B. Gloyeski
Feb. 3, 1918 - Jan. 12, 2005
Gertrude B. Gloyeski, 86, of US 20, South Bend, passed away at 4:55 a.m. on Wednesday, January 12, 2005, in her residence. She was born on February 3, 1918, in North Liberty, Indiana, to John and Mary (Jasinski) Staszewski, who preceded her in death. On June 28, 1945, in Denver, Colorado, she married Irvin A. Gloyeski, who passed away on August 7, 1998. Surviving Gertrude are five children, David (Carol) Gloyeski of Bon Aqua, Tennessee, Mary (Paul) Barnett of Boca Raton, Florida, Carol (Pat) Fagan of Newburgh, Indiana, Michael (Anita) Gloyeski of Indianapolis, Indiana, and Dale (Jie) Gloyeski of Mission Viejo, California; grandchildren, Patrick (Toni) Fagan, Sean Fagan, Erin Fagan, Karen (Pete) McRay and Ryan Gloyeski; sisters, Elenore Choinacky of South Bend, Geraldine Rothballer of South Bend and Henrietta (Martin) Steinhofer of South Bend; and brothers, Irvin (Nancy) Staszewski of South Bend, Eugene (Bernice) Staszewski of New Carlisle and Clem (Joan) Staszewski of Largo, Florida. Gertrude was a member of St. John the Baptist. She loved to knit and crochet, write poetry and work in her garden. Gertrude took great pride in her home.
